>Look, I didn't invent 'date of cessation of presumption of 
>conformity of
>the superseded standard' - that's probably down to someone in the
>Commission's legal department. I just balked at typing it out over and
>over again, so I just copied the 'doa', 'dop', 'dow' system. The
>initials might have produced an even less elegant 'word'.
